The Tiffen 82mm UV Haze-1 Filter is a wise initial investment. It is the standard UV filter most people are familiar with. It can help protect your valuable investment from dust, moisture and scratches, which can lead to costly repairs.
A UV filter not only minimizes the bluish cast sometimes found under daylight conditions, but is also the best available protection against accidental damage to the front element of your lens. A lens that accidentally gets dropped on its front element while hiking can potentially be saved by purchasing this item. Some people refer to it as "cheap insurance". As a lens protector, it should be left on at all times.
Aside from that more-than-significant benefit, UV filters render your photos clearer, sharper and more contrasty. This filter will eliminate approximately 3/4 of the disturbing UV contamination in your image. For those who enjoy outdoor photography, especially distant vistas, a UV filter can produce a more distinct and acceptable image by removing much of the blue tint normally associated with atmospheric haze.
Eliminates much of the Ultraviolet (UV) light which can register on film and videotape as a bluish cast that can obscure distant details
If desired, they can be left on the lens at all times for protection
Ultraviolet filters allow you to correct for the UV effect to varying degrees
Especially valuable as a general lens protector
Guards against fingerprints and scratches to the front element of your lens
